Introduction:
Flying can be a exhilarating experience, but encountering technical issues while onboard can be unnerving for passengers. However, it’s important to remain calm and follow the guidance of the cabin crew and aviation professionals. This article aims to provide useful tips on how to handle technical issues while flying to ensure a safe and reliable travel experience.

1. Stay Informed:
– Keep an eye on the flight attendants and listen to all announcements carefully. They will provide you with updates or instructions regarding any technical issues.

2. Remain Calm:
– It’s natural to feel anxious, but staying calm is crucial. Panicking can exacerbate the situation and cause unnecessary chaos.

3. Follow Crew Instructions:
– Cabin crew are trained to handle emergencies and technical malfunctions efficiently. Follow their instructions promptly and without hesitation.

4. Trust Aviation Professionals:
– Remember that pilots and aviation professionals are highly trained and experienced. They have the necessary knowledge and skills to handle technical issues and ensure a safe flight.

5. Utilize Safety Equipment:
– Familiarize yourself with the aircraft’s safety features, including seatbelts, oxygen masks, and emergency exits. This knowledge will help you act swiftly if needed.

6. Communicate with the Cabin Crew:
– If you have concerns or questions, calmly communicate them to the cabin crew. They will address your concerns and provide appropriate solutions.

7. Report Suspicious Noises or Odors:
– If you notice unusual sounds or smells, bring them to the crew’s attention. This could be an indicator of potential technical problems that need examination.

8. Avoid Looking out the Windows:
– During a technical issue, refrain from looking out the window. This can create unnecessary panic, especially if other passengers are visibly worried.

9. Be Respectful of Others:
– Stay calm for the sake of other passengers. If you are uneasy, try to control your emotions to prevent panic from spreading.

10. Understand Diversion Procedures:
– In case the flight is diverted due to technical problems, be aware of the procedures and protocols that will be followed. Follow instructions provided by the crew.

11. Keep Belongings at Hand:
– Ensure your personal belongings, such as identification, travel documents, and medication, are easily accessible in case you need them during a technical issue.

12. Listen to Pre-flight Safety Briefings:
– Pay attention to safety demonstrations or pre-flight briefings. These instructions will guide you on the use of safety equipment and emergency procedures.

13. Stay in Your Seat:
– Unless the cabin crew instructs you otherwise, remain seated during technical issues. Loose objects or movement within the cabin could hamper the crew’s work.

14. Use the Call Button When Needed:
– If you require immediate assistance or have pressing concerns, use the call button above your seat. The crew will attend to you promptly.

15. Avoid Speculating:
– Refrain from sharing speculations or creating unnecessary panic among fellow passengers. Rely on official information provided by the crew.

16. Patience is Key:
– While technical issues are inconvenient, remember that rectifying them can take time. Patience is crucial, as the flight crew works diligently towards resolving the problem.

17. Follow Expert Advice:
– Trust the expertise of aviation professionals to handle technical issues. Avoid seeking solutions from unfamiliar sources, as it may lead to misinformation or unnecessary panic.

18. Document the Issue (If Applicable):
– If you notice a technical issue, document it discreetly using your smartphone or a notepad. This information might be useful later when reporting the incident to the airline.
